In 1985, Newberg High School organized its first ever Grad Night Party. In 1999, the Newberg Grad Night Committee was established as a non-profit 501c3 with the State of Oregon. Over the years parents of graduating seniors have worked hard to raise funds and organize a safe and fun evening for their graduates.

What is Grad Night?

Grad Night is a Safe and Sober Graduation Night Celebration sponsored by Newberg High School Parents and community donations.

For the protection of the students, and to eliminate any opportunity for drugs and alcohol to be snuck in, the location of Grad Night is kept top-secret until the students are on the bus and ready to disembark.
